Southern Style Collard Greens
Southern Style Collard Greens are a hearty and flavorful vegan dish that celebrates the rich culinary traditions of the American South. This recipe features tender collard greens simmered with spices and a hint of smokiness, making it a perfect side for any barbecue meal.

Ingredients
- Collard greens - 300 grams, chopped
- Olive oil - 2 tablespoons
- Onion - 1 medium, diced
- Garlic - 3 cloves, minced
- Vegetable broth - 500 milliliters
- Apple cider vinegar - 1 tablespoon
- Maple syrup - 1 teaspoon
- Smoked paprika - 1 teaspoon
- Red pepper flakes - 1/4 teaspoon (optional)
- Salt - to taste
- Black pepper - to taste
Steps
- In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and sauté until translucent, about 5 minutes.
- Add the minced garlic to the pot and sauté for another minute until fragrant.
- Stir in the chopped collard greens, vegetable broth, apple cider vinegar, maple syrup, smoked paprika, red pepper flakes, salt, and black pepper.
- Bring the mixture to a simmer, then reduce the heat to low. Cover and let it cook for about 30 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the collard greens are tender.
-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Serve warm as a side dish.
